Soundproof Music and Podcast Studio Remodels in Orland Park

Plenty of Orland Park basements were finished decades ago, with paneling, drop ceilings, and zero thought given to sound. Homeowners here are less often starting from bare concrete and more often asking us to tear out a dated space and rebuild part of it as a proper studio.

That remodel path works well. We strip the affected area to structure, install decoupled framing and mass-loaded walls, add a sealed sound-rated door and quiet ventilation, then refinish everything to current standards. Permits are required when electrical or plumbing changes, and ONIT handles them start to finish.

What's included

  • Decoupled room-in-room framing
  • Mass-loaded and insulated wall assemblies
  • Sound-rated doors with full seals
  • Acoustic treatment tuned to the room
  • Quiet ventilation that will not hum in a mic
  • Dedicated clean-power circuits
  • Cable runs and equipment layouts
  • Drum, band, and podcast configurations
